- [ ] Step 7: Archive cold storage buckets (Glacierline tier). Confirm both ceremony witnesses are present, verify bucket manifests match the Oxbow ledger, then seal the archive key shares. Plugin authors may observe but not handle shares. Once sealed, the archive index itself is encrypted and can only be reopened with the passphrase below.

vault phrase of badup-hahig = tamael-aldael-kelmir-istael-fenok-istwyn-tamius-jorath-oliion

## Cron-to-Orchestro cutover

During the maintenance window, disable the legacy cron host, then enable the equivalent Orchestro workflows in dependency order: ingest, rollup, notify. Confirm the first scheduled run of each completes before closing the window. Rollback is re-enabling cron and pausing workflows. Deploying workflow definitions requires signing them; use the deploy key below.

signing key of bagap-yawep = bky13_TbfT6ZMUoGJo2

### v3.2.0 — Renamed setting

Keyspindle no longer reads `KS_ROTATE_TOKEN`; it was renamed for consistency with the plugin API. Plugins targeting 3.2+ must use the new name or rotation hooks will not fire. The old name is ignored silently — no deprecation warning is emitted. Update your `.env` before upgrading. Keep `KS_PLUGIN_DIR` and `KS_LOG_LEVEL` as-is. Immediately after those entries, add the renamed token line with your existing value.

secret setting of kawif-kajef: COURIER_KEY3=d2b

// Broker upgrade notes for plugin authors:
// Quillbus 4.x replaces the legacy 3.x wire protocol. Plugins must
// construct the client with explicit protocol negotiation enabled,
// or connections to the Larkfield cluster will be silently downgraded
// and dropped after 30s. Topic names are unchanged. For local testing
// against the sandbox broker, authenticate with the key below.

API key for bafof-bagaf: qvz2-qi

Subject: Tilepiper prefetcher update shipping today

Team — the map-tile prefetcher in Tilepiper 4.2 now fetches two zoom levels ahead instead of one, which cuts blank-tile reports on slow connections but raises bandwidth use slightly. If customers mention data-cap concerns, point them to the new "lean prefetch" toggle under Map Settings. Known issue: offline regions saved before this release may re-download once. Roll-back path is the 4.1 hotfix channel. When escalating tickets, include the build stamp shown below.

trace token, fafog-kageg: htk4_98e6